Description

No. 3 Emmanuel Road is a mid-19th century building constructed of grey gault brick. It stands two storeys high and is divided into bays by four brick pilasters. The façade features two windows on the ground floor and three above, all of which are sash windows with glazing bars. The entrance consists of a panelled door with a rectangular light above, framed by fluted pilasters and topped with a pediment. The building has a parapet, and while the roof is not visible, it is likely to be slate.
